Rear view monitor display malfunction (distortion of the color/screen) occurs temporarily |
Check the usage conditions (explain to the customer that the display may be temporarily distorted when the vehicle is close to an object that transmits radio waves, such as a telecommunication tower, an airport or a truck equipped with a transceiver) |
